Video: Lee Gratton Winter XC Race Training

Mar 14, 2014
by Thomas Gaffney  


Lee Gratton is a midlands based rider riding for Trek Coventry in 2014.

Originally coming from a downhill background Lee raced in the British Downhill Series for a few years but never really broke top 10 in the senior category. He didn't have much luck and through the time I've known him he always had always had some sort of problem come race run with punctures and chains snapping which brought his races to an abrupt end. He has also overcome some massive crashes. In 2008 he hit a tree and had surgery on his knee and he also took a tumble breaking his wrist and collar bone late in the 2013 season.

Despite the setbacks Lee never stopped and in fact found a new love in Cross Country racing. Due to a crash in training last year he had to miss the last 3 races but was so far up on points he was still promoted into the elite category where he will be racing in 2014. This year he has gone all out, dropping his job to part time hours and getting out riding as much as possible and training for the season ahead. He is an absolute whippet up the hills and a monster on the downhills due to his previous background so expectations are high, but I've no doubt he can do really well.
